Commercial Lot Clearing in Atlanta, GA
Commercial lot clearing services involve removing trees, brush, debris, and other obstructions to prepare a property for development, construction, or landscaping projects. This process can include land grading, stump removal, and debris hauling to create a clean, level space suitable for building or other use. Property owners often request this service when starting new construction, expanding existing structures, or improving land usability, ensuring the site meets zoning and safety requirements before proceeding with development plans.
Before requesting commercial lot clearing, property owners should consider the size and current condition of the land, including any existing structures or vegetation that may need special handling. It’s also important to understand local regulations regarding land clearing, permits required, and environmental considerations that could impact the scope of work. Clear communication about project goals and land features can help ensure the process aligns with the desired outcome for the property.

Commercial Lot Clearing Questions
What types of commercial lots require clearing? Clearing services are suitable for various properties, including undeveloped land, sites for new construction, and areas needing vegetation removal before development.
What equipment is used for lot clearing? Heavy machinery such as bulldozers, excavators, and loaders are typically used to efficiently clear vegetation and debris from commercial sites.
Is lot clearing necessary before construction? Yes, clearing removes trees, brush, and other obstructions to prepare the land for building or development projects.
What should property owners consider before clearing? It's important to assess the land's topography, existing vegetation, and any local regulations or permits required for clearing activities.
